Signal Specification, Control Module For Rear Audio Separation

U= DC voltage in volts (V) UAC = AC voltage in volts (V)
Ubat = Battery voltage (V) f = Frequency in Hertz (Hz)
Ulow = Voltage approximately 0 V t = Time in seconds
PWM = Pulse width modulated signal as a % - -

SIGNAL TABLE

Terminal  Signal type  Ignition on  Other 
#A1 Battery voltage supply Ubat -
#A2 Right-hand audio (out) audio channel 2 - Headset signal channel 2, low level audio
#A3 Left-hand audio (out) audio channel 2 - Headset signal channel 2, low level audio
#A4 15 supply Ubat -
#A5 Left-hand audio (out) audio channel 1 - Headset signal channel 1, low level audio
#A6 Right-hand audio (out) audio channel 1 - Headset signal channel 1, low level audio
#A7 - - -
#A8 Loudspeaker signal left-hand (L-) U = Ulow Rear loudspeakers, high level audio
#A9 Loudspeaker signal left-hand (R-) - Rear loudspeakers, high level audio
#A10 Loudspeaker signal left-hand (R+) - Rear loudspeakers, high level audio
#A11 Loudspeaker signal left-hand (L+) - Rear loudspeakers, high level audio
#A12 Incoming loudspeaker sound (L+) - The control module for rear audio separation receives audio signals from the standard system and processes the sound
#A13 Ground supply Ulow -
#A14 - - -
#A15 Audio ground - -
#A16 - - -
#A17 - - -
#A18 Channel selector ground 0 V = no signal at all
5 V = left-hand display screen audio in loudspeaker (master)
7.5 V = right-hand display screen audio in loudspeaker (master)
The left-hand passenger position sound is always in the left-hand headphone and vice versa
#A19 - - -
#A20 - - -
#A21 Incoming loudspeaker sound (R-) Alternating current at sound in center loudspeaker The control module for rear audio separation receives audio signals from the standard system and processes the sound
#A22 Incoming loudspeaker sound (R+) - The control module for rear audio separation receives audio signals from the standard system and processes the sound
#A23 Incoming loudspeaker sound (L-) - The control module for rear audio separation receives audio signals from the standard system and processes the sound
#A24 - - -
SIGNAL TABLE

Terminal  Signal type  Ignition on  Other 
#B1 Infra-red supply 5 V Infra-red receiver headsets
#B2 Infra-red audio Hi Low level Twisted
#B3 Infra-red audio Lo Low level Twisted
#B4 Ground Ulow -
